Job Description
The Fitness Specialist is responsible for conducting one-on-one and group training exercise sessions with members and non-members. Other duties include exercise testing and evaluation, and the development of appropriate exercise programs. Performs various duties assigned by department management according to policies and procedures and the mission of Woman's Hospital.
Requirements:
- Bachelor's degree required, preferably in Kinesiology or a health-related discipline.
- Three years of experience in personal training and/or exercise instruction preferred.
- National certification in personal training or exercise physiology required within 90 days of hire.
Responsibilities:
- Seeks out opportunities to teach Group Classes and teaches Group Classes as requested by management.
- Performs appropriate movement screens and selects fitness tests that are both safe and appropriate for the individual.
- Utilizes assessment protocols and program skills as documented in member files and reviewed on a quarterly basis by fitness services supervisor.
- Reviews of random fitness training programs to ensure the latest ACSM guidelines, member goals and assessment results are met which includes the information in the exercise programs prior to the training session with the member.
- Assists with equipment cleaning and maintenance.
- Rotates through the member retention committee meetings and contributes constructive ideas verbally, in writing and follow through.
- Completes a minimum of three CEU courses related to primary responsibilities and reports information learned at either monthly fitness staff meetings or personal trainer retreats.
- Any other duties as assigned by Woman's Hospital.
Schedule:
Monday - Friday: 3:00 PM - 8:00 PM
Rotating weekends
Pay Range:
Hourly/Non-Exempt
$17.00 - $24.00; based on work experience
